I've already ranked their films so now I will rank the princesses individually. Share your thoughts. My opinions are always changing so this liste might not always be the same in my head.
13. Aurora
I l’amour her film but she really is the worst, most boring part of it. Sure, she's beautiful and has one of the best chant voices of any princess but she is just so bland. And I can't place a character who only appears for around 18 minutes any higher on this list. She's nice but really needed plus of a personality especially since her film has such memorable characters.
12. Cinderella
I used to think that she was the worst and most overrated but now I see that at least she has plus spunk and personality than Aurora and she plays a bigger part in her movie. I understand that the classic princesses are products of their time so they aren't exactly going to fight back but I think that Cendrillon is the most determined and shows the most intelligence plus she has her sassy moments. I still think she looks too much like a generic princess but she's still classy.
11. Belle
I just don't like Belle very much. I think she is so incredibly overrated. Sure, she looks nice most of the time although she has several bad shots and she likes to read, which is nice, but she just comes across as being too perfect. I like that she is smart and that she stands up to Beast and helps her father and that she ignores Gaston but she is still kind of boring and plain-looking. She's a good princess but not the best. I wish she was plus playful and made plus mistakes so that she would seem less perfect. She's not unique enough.
10. Jasmine
I was really debating whether I should switch jasmin with Belle but I like jasmin just a little plus because she has a better chant voice (Lea Salonga!) and she's plus unique. This girl is spunky, which I like and she's smart and independent. She's my least favori character from Aladin and I kind of forget about her sometimes but she is not a bad princess, just not the best but thank the Lord she's not as goody-goody and perfect as some of the others.
9. Snow White
I don't understand why Snow White is higher up than Belle ou Jasmine, I don't know why I like her so much but I do. This one is kind of surprising to me because really Snow White does very little aside from work and sing but I just like her. She's charming. I have always loved her clothes and even though she has one of the least appealing voices to modern audiences I have a soft spot for it and her in general. Maybe because she's the first princess. I always think she's underrated because of her admittedly strange voice and old fashioned look.
8. Tiana
I was thinking of making Tiana #9 but I decided to cut her some slack. I'm not a big fan of her film, its alright but not my cup of tea, and think she's alittle too unrealistically perfect and she sort has a one track mind but she is still nice. I thought that at first she was too preachy but I started to like her plus as the film progressed. She is beautiful and has a very nice voice global, ensemble and one of the best dresses. She's also hardworking, determined, intelligent, and a good role model although I would have just asked charlotte for the money a long time ago. Still, I like her spunk and can see why people like her even though she was kind of annoying and no fun with Naveen at first. I wish she was plus playful.
7. Elsa
I really like Elsa. She's pretty, unique, strong, and has a nice sense of style and of course ice powers but I feel like we never really get to know Elsa well. She's almost always worried, scared ou serious in her scenes. I wish they had shown her plus playful, happy side that we see a glimpse of during "Let it Go" and at the end. Speaking of "Let it Go", does anyone else think that change was just a little drastic. How could she just up and choose to forget about her sister and accueil so quickly. Still, I like the song even if I prefer Anna's voice since Idina's( ou Adele Dazeem's) voice can be alittle shrieky in the high notes. Nevertheless, if their is going to be a La Reine des Neiges 2 I hope we get to know Elsa better. I did like how she cared for Anna, except during her song, and didn't let her marry Hans.
6. Ariel
My mom's favorite. I think she is the most beautiful princess and she has a very nice voice but she is a bit of a brat, yes I know she's 16, and falls for Eric and is willing to sell her voice to Ursula of all people to get near him. She doesn't really think through things very well. What if he didn't like her? How would they communicate? They both spoke English so why didn't she just write to him? What did she do with her stuffed crab? So many questions that we won't know the answer to. Still, she is brave, fun-loving, and determined. She's stubborn like Tiana but for a different reason. I l’amour her spirit of wonder and adventure though.
5. Merida
I l’amour this girl. She is strong, brave, unique, and spunky. She's not the prettiest princess. traditionally but she has an interesting and different brand of style and beauty. I like that she's an archer and that she just wants to be herself and independent. She's pulls an Ariel on us and consults a witch which was obviously a bad idea and she can be hot headed, although Elinor was a little annoying, but she works hard to fix her mistakes. She's human, we all make mistakes. I like her fierce spirit and am happy that so many people have embraced her.
4. Pocahontas
I really l’amour this princess. She is so centered, mature, caring, and intelligent and I l’amour that she is so natural and really cares for the environment and tells John Smith a thing ou two about his "modern" ideas. I like that she looks like no other princess, she has a short dress, a tattoo, loose hair, she seems like the tallest princess and she's always barefoot. She's unique and I l’amour her for that. And that chant voice of hers is the best, it is so powerful and interesting. I l’amour that she is so Rebelle and adventurous.
3. Anna
I l’amour this girl. She's definitely the funniest, liveliest and most modern princess except for the whole wanting marry Hans thing. She's no genius but she is genuine. She is pretty and quirky and seems like the most playful princess. She also has some spunk and I actually like her voice, its not the strongest but its sweet and great coming from a non singer like Kristen Bell. I also like her clothes and braids. She is so charming and silly but she's also caring and determined.
2. Rapunzel
I don't think Anna and Rapunzel are exactly the same, they are similar but I think Rapunzel is plus poised and intelligent. She's also very artistic, which I like. She has spunk too and can wield a frying pan like nobody else. She is a dreamer and determined which I l’amour and aside from her hair she acts like a real, modern girl. She has a sweetness and inner feu about her that I really like. She is cute-pretty and has a nice, playful voice although it is not as strong as some others and has a plus pop sound to it. I like how she became plus mature as the film progressed but I only wish that she had kept her hair fairly long, I like short hair but not for her because I like the longer hair more. I still like her.
1. Mulan
I l’amour this girl. She is the absolute best princess-heroine hands down. She is realistic because she is clumsy at first but works hard to better herself. She becomes a better warrior than any of the men and ends up saving the jour twice and killing the villain, and she is one of only two princesses to do so (the other being Tiana). She is pretty, funny, and mature and seems like a real, modern girl who can montrer that women can do whatever men do. She also has a great voice, courtesy of Lea Salonga and Ming Na Wen, and their really isn't another princess as Rebelle and strong as she is. I don't care if she really isn't a princess, she is the best and I can't really complain about her ou her film.
